My Story

My Name Is Shagun Banga. Md At Technocrat Mouldings Pvt Ltd. Education: Be Mechanical (Engg.). Certifications In Machine Design. Simulation In Solidworks Cad Software. Author of the book ''The sole of Success

Why Choose Us

36 + Year Experience
650 +

1350 + Machines Sold

After Sale Services

In 1992, my father had a business of manufacturing recycled PVC granules. One day, he saw a costly Italian machine at a client’s factory, and learned that it was too expensive for many businesses. But my dad got an idea – why not make a machine like that, but one we could all afford? So, my father decided to make a similar, affordable machine in India. It was tough because he wasn’t a technical person, but after two years of hard work, he did it. Thanks to him, lots of small factories in India started to grow and do better.

Since my childhood, I saw my dad working really hard every single day. I saw all the tough times he went through and the great things he accomplished. This made me want to do my part, so I chose to study mechanical engineering in college. After I got my BTech degree, I joined our family business in 2002. At that time, we were making only a handful of machines, and most of the big factories liked to buy the fancier, high-tech imported machines.

At first, people just thought our machines were a cheaper choice than the ones from abroad. But I had bigger dreams. I wanted our company to be the best at making machines in India. I aimed to build machines that weren’t just as good, but better and more advanced than the ones we used to import.

This ambition aligned perfectly with Prime Minister Modi’s ‘Make in India’ initiative, which inspired me even further. I committed myself to extensive learning, taking specialized courses in machine design, hydraulics, and electrical systems. I was determined to stay abreast of the latest technologies, always thinking, researching, and striving for improvement. The journey was filled with trial and error, a series of challenges to overcome, but I stayed the course, driven by a vision of excellence and national pride. Throughout our journey, we’ve not only met but also surpassed many milestones, establishing ourselves as the top footwear sole machinery manufacturer in India. We proudly offer a line of machines that represent the pinnacle of industry innovation and operational efficiency. As innovators in the Indian market, we have introduced an extensive range of machinery, including pioneering developments in single, double, and triple color sole and insole machines, along with EVA hot and cold presses—all industry firsts in India. Our dedication to quality and innovation has garnered us a strong client base of over 600 satisfied customers, and we have sold more than 1420 machines to date. A remarkable indicator of our success is that some of our clients have up to 80 stations of our machinery running in a single factory. This level of client commitment highlights the trust in our brand and the proven performance of our products in high-demand production settings.

We are India’s Leading Sole Manufacturing Machinery Supplier.
We hold the distinction of being the first to manufacture these machines in India.

Single-Color TPR Sole Molding Machine - 1992. Welt Insert Book Winding Machine - 1998. Double Color TPR Sole Making Machine - 2015. Shoe Last Moulding Machine - 2017. Eva Hot and Cold Machine - 2023. Triple Color Sole Machine - 2023

Our Clients

We treat our customers as our partners. That helps them explain their ideas fluently and grow their organization to the fullest with the best support.

Our Machines Make Soles For Top International Shoe Brands

Our success is when our customers get the chance to exceed their expectations. Check out the latest success stories.

Frequently Asked Question

Why Choose Us?

Technocrat moldings are engaged in manufacturing footwear related machinery to manufacture tpr soles, Insole (Memory Foam), Airmix Soles, Shoe last and other footwear components.

We are India’s Leading Sole Manufacturing Machinery Supplier.

What types of materials are compatible with your machines?

Our machines are versatile and can work with a variety of materials commonly used in footwear sole production, including TPU, TPR, PVC, EVA, and rubber.

How can I contact Technocrat Mouldings for inquiries?

Please Call or WhatsApp us for more details at – + 91 81680 45814 | +91 99115 04006 

You can reach us through the “Contact Us” section on our website or by emailing

What kind of support do you provide post-purchase?

We provide ongoing technical support, maintenance services, and assistance to ensure the smooth operation of our machines throughout their lifecycle.

How long does it take to receive a quote for a specific machine?

Our sales team strives to provide quotes promptly. The timeline may vary based on the complexity of your requirements, but we aim to respond within a reasonable timeframe.

Resources To Follow

Sweet Words From Clients

Hear What Our Clients Are Saying About Working With Our Team.

Highly recommend

I recently purchased a machine from Technocrat and I must say that I am extremely impressed with its performance. Having purchased several machines from Technocrat in the past,

I had high expectations, and once again, they did not disappoint.

The power saving drives and hydraulics ejectors in the machine are top- notch, and they have helped me save a lot of energy and costs.

Technocrat truly delivers the best quality machines in the market. I highly recommend them to anyone in need of a reliable and efficient machine.



Fill This Form To Continue

fill this form to continue